enterprising spirit
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
"enterprising spirit" is a correct and usable phrase in written English.
It is used to describe someone who is driven and ambitious in their endeavors. For example, "With an enterprising spirit, she was determined to make her business a success."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When describing a person's capacity to identify and pursue opportunities, using the phrase "enterprising spirit" can add depth. Ensure that the context aligns with the individual's proactive and resourceful nature.
Common error
Avoid using "enterprising spirit" when describing routine tasks or actions lacking genuine initiative. It's best reserved for situations where someone demonstrates unique resourcefulness and proactive problem-solving.

More alternative expressions(6)
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
initiative and drive
Combines the qualities of taking initiative and possessing the energy to pursue goals.
entrepreneurial drive
Focuses on the entrepreneurial aspect, emphasizing the motivation and energy to start and manage ventures.
resourceful nature
Highlights the ability to find clever ways to overcome difficulties and achieve goals.
inventive streak
Emphasizes a natural tendency for creativity and resourcefulness in problem-solving.
innovative mindset
Emphasizes the inclination towards generating new ideas and approaches.
proactive approach
Stresses the quality of taking initiative and acting in anticipation of future needs.
dynamic approach
Highlights an active and energetic method in tackling challenges and opportunities.
ambitious disposition
Highlights a strong desire for success or achievement.
bold initiative
Focuses on the courage to take the first step and pursue new opportunities.
go-getter attitude
Implies a dynamic and proactive approach to achieving goals, often in a business setting.
FAQs
How can I use "enterprising spirit" in a sentence?
You can use "enterprising spirit" to describe someone who is resourceful and takes initiative in pursuing opportunities. For example, "Her "enterprising spirit" led her to start her own business."
What's a good substitute for "enterprising spirit"?
Alternatives include "entrepreneurial drive", "resourceful nature", or "innovative mindset" depending on the specific aspect you want to emphasize.
Is "enterprising spirit" formal or informal?
"Enterprising spirit" is generally considered a neutral to slightly formal phrase, suitable for both professional and academic contexts. Using terms such as "go-getter attitude" is less appropriate in formal situations.
What characterizes an "enterprising spirit"?
An "enterprising spirit" is characterized by a proactive approach, resourcefulness, and a willingness to take initiative in pursuing opportunities and overcoming challenges. It often involves creativity and a desire to achieve goals.
